squabble
definition
squab·ble (skwäb′əl)
intransitive verb squabbled -·bled, squabbling -·bling
to quarrel noisily over a small matter; wrangle
Etymology: < Scand as in Swed skvabbel, a dispute
noun
a noisy, petty quarrel or dispute; wrangle
Related Forms:
- squabbler squab′·bler noun
